## Prompt Body

Act as a senior Codex & Coding specialist using ChatGPT. Your task is: [Goal or task].

Context:
- Current situation: [Current context]
- Constraints: [Constraints]
- Available materials: [Files, data, examples, URLs, logs, notes]
- Success criteria: [Definition of done]

Workflow:
1. Restate the objective in operational terms and identify any missing information that would block a reliable answer.
2. Make reasonable assumptions only when they are low risk, and label them clearly.
3. Produce the main deliverable for "WordPress Plugin Development Prompt" with enough detail that a skilled operator can execute it immediately.
4. Include edge cases, failure modes, dependencies, and tradeoffs that a junior prompt would usually miss.
5. Add a verification checklist with concrete tests, review questions, metrics, or acceptance criteria.
6. End with the smallest safe next action.

Output format:
- Executive summary
- Detailed plan or implementation
- Risks and mitigations
- Verification checklist
- Next action

Do not give generic advice. Optimize for a production-quality plugin development outcome.
